What is a Quantitative Researcher?

A quantitative researcher is a professional who conducts research using quantitative methods and techniques. They play a crucial role in various fields such as market research, social sciences, finance, and data analysis. The primary objective of a quantitative researcher is to collect, analyze, and interpret data to uncover patterns, trends, relationships, and insights.

In this role, a quantitative researcher employs a structured and systematic approach to gather data, often using statistical tools, techniques, and software. They formulate research questions and hypotheses, design research studies, develop measurement instruments, and select appropriate sampling techniques to ensure the accuracy and representativeness of the data collected. These researchers often utilize surveys, experiments, and secondary data sources to gather information.

Once the data is collected, a quantitative researcher cleans and organizes it to ensure data integrity. They then use statistical models to analyze the data, identifying and testing hypotheses, establishing correlations, and making predictions or inferences. This involves employing advanced statistical techniques such as regression analysis, ANOVA, factor analysis, and data mining.

Furthermore, a quantitative researcher is also responsible for interpreting the findings of the analysis and communicating them to different audiences, such as clients, stakeholders, or academic communities. They may present their findings in written reports, research papers, presentations, or visualizations, using graphs, charts, and tables to illustrate the results effectively.

Precision, attention to detail, and critical thinking skills are vital for a quantitative researcher, as they must ensure the validity and reliability of their data and analysis. Additionally, proficiency in statistical software packages like SPSS, SAS, or R is essential, as these tools help in managing, analyzing, and visualizing large datasets efficiently.

Overall, a quantitative researcher is a key player in generating evidence-based insights, driving decision-making processes, and contributing to the advancement of knowledge in various fields. Their meticulous work and analytical expertise play a vital role in addressing complex problems, improving processes, and furthering understanding in academic, business, and social contexts.

How to become a Quantitative Researcher?

To become a quantitative researcher, here are some steps you can take:

1. Education: Obtain a strong foundation in mathematics, statistics, and analysis. Pursue a Bachelor's degree in a relevant field such as mathematics, statistics, economics, computer science, or engineering.

2. Graduate degree: Consider pursuing a Master's or Ph.D. in a quantitative field such as applied mathematics, financial engineering, economics, or computational science. This will provide a deeper understanding of advanced quantitative techniques and research methodologies.

3. Develop programming skills: Learn programming languages commonly used in quantitative research, such as Python, R, or MATLAB. Proficiency in programming will allow you to implement and test quantitative models.

4. Gain relevant experience: Look for internships or entry-level positions in research or data analysis roles. This will help you gain practical experience in using quantitative methodologies and working with research data.

5. Sharpen analytical skills: Develop critical thinking abilities and problem-solving skills. Practice identifying patterns, trends, and correlations in data sets and be proficient in analyzing and interpreting complex data.

6. Stay updated: Continuously enhance your knowledge of quantitative methods, statistical models, and emerging research techniques. Read academic papers, join relevant forums, attend conferences, and participate in online courses or workshops to stay up-to-date with advancements in the field.

7. Build a portfolio: Create a portfolio of your research work, including projects or publications that showcase your proficiency in quantitative analysis. This will help demonstrate your skills and expertise to potential employers.

8. Networking: Connect with professionals in the field, join relevant communities, and attend industry events to expand your network. Networking can provide valuable opportunities for mentorship, collaboration, and potential job prospects.

9. Apply for jobs: Look for job opportunities in research institutions, financial firms, consulting companies, or academic institutions. Tailor your resume and cover letter to highlight your quantitative skills and research experience.

10. Continuous learning: Keep learning and adapting to new technologies, methodologies, and research trends. The field of quantitative research is constantly evolving, so it is important to stay updated and continue developing your skills throughout your career.

What are the responsibilities for a Quantitative Researcher?

The responsibilities of a "Quantitative Researcher" typically involve conducting in-depth data analysis to generate insights and recommendations for investment decisions. This includes developing and implementing quantitative models, strategies, and frameworks for evaluating financial markets and assets. A quantitative researcher is responsible for collecting and processing large datasets using statistical and programming techniques, such as Python, R, or MATLAB. They design and backtest trading algorithms, quantitative models, and risk management strategies. The role requires staying updated with industry trends and academic research to incorporate new methodologies. Effective communication skills are necessary for presenting complex findings to team members and stakeholders. A quantitative researcher may also collaborate with traders, portfolio managers, and technology teams to optimize trading systems and enhance investment performance.
